What is a highest RBT?

The term 'highest RBT' typically refers to the highest-paid or most experienced Registered Behavior Technician (RBT). RBTs are paraprofessionals certified to implement behavior analysis services under the supervision of a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A). The highest-earning RBTs often have several years of experience, advanced training, and may work in specialized settings or regions with higher pay rates. While RBTs do not have official rank distinctions, those with additional certifications or leadership roles may command higher salaries. The role itself focuses on helping clients, often children with autism, develop social and life skills through behavior intervention plans.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T)?

To thrive as a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T), you need knowledge of applied behavior analysis (ABA) principles, a high school diploma (or equivalent), and completion of RBT certification requirements. Familiarity with data collection tools, behavior intervention plans, and progress tracking systems is typically required. Strong communication, patience, and the ability to build rapport with clients and families are essential soft skills. These qualifications ensure effective implementation of behavior plans and positive outcomes for individuals receiving behavioral therapy.

How does a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) typically collaborate with Board Certified Behavior Analysts (BCBAs) and other team members?

As a Registered Behavior Technician (RBT), you will work closely under the supervision of Board Certified Behavior Analysts (BCBAs), implementing behavior intervention plans and collecting data on client progress. Collaboration is key; you'll frequently communicate client observations, participate in team meetings, and adjust your approach based on feedback from supervisors and other specialists, such as speech or occupational therapists. This teamwork ensures that each client receives coordinated, effective care and provides valuable learning opportunities for RBTs to grow their skills.
